In many pharmaceutical processes — such as tablet coating, handling of porous materials, and sterile manufacturing — precise humidity and temperature control, along with a continuous supply of 100% fresh, clean air, are essential to ensure consistent product quality. Improperly conditioned environments, surface condensation, and heat generated by equipment (especially in cleanrooms) can lead to significant product damage and costly losses.

Additional key advantages of our solutions
Energy Efficiency
With our innovative climate control technology, electrical input energy can be reduced by up to 90% compared to conventional compressor-based cooling systems. To deliver 30–40 kWh of cooling performance and continuous fresh air ventilation, the system requires only 1 kWh of electricity.
